ftp允许上传
1、下载软件FileZilla(用的比较多的一款),
‘贰’ 设置FTP特定用户有上传新文件的权限
设置FTP特定用户有上传新文件的权限的具体方法步骤如下:
1,在桌面上右击“我的电脑”,执行“管理”命令,在“计算机管理”窗口的左窗格中依次展开“系统工具”→“本地用户和组”目录,单击选中“用户”选项。在右侧窗格中单击右键,执行“新用户”命令。在打开的“新用户”对话框中填写用户名(如hanjiang),并设定密码。然后取消“用户下次登录时需更改密码”复选框,并勾选“用户不能更改密码”和“密码永不过期”复选框,单击“创建”按钮完成该用户的添加。重复这一过程添加其他用户,最后单击“关闭”按钮即可。
2,为方便对这些用户的管理,最好将他们放入一个专门的组中。创建一个“FTPUsers”组:在“计算机管理”窗口的目录树中单击选中“组”选项,然后在右侧窗格中单击右键,执行“新建组”命令,并将该组命名为“FTPUsers”。接着依次单击“添加”→“高级”→“立即查找”按钮,将刚才创建的用户全部添加进来,最后依次单击“创建”→“结束”按钮。
3,因为上述创建的用户默认隶属于“Users”组,也就是说他们拥有对大部分资源的浏览权限。为了实现对特定资源的有效管理,需要将这些用户从“Users”组中删除。在“计算机管理”窗口的右侧窗格中双击“Users”选项,用鼠标拖选所有刚添加的用户并单击“删除”按钮即可。
‘叁’ 怎样设置FTP上传文件
/etc/ftpaccess是ftpd的设置文件,也就是作为设置ftpd操作方式的一个文件。其功能比较复杂,这里只就文件上传设定的方式作个说明。 [语法] upload [absolute|relative] [class=]... [-] ["dirs"|"nodirs"] [] [说明] 定义这个目录是允许或拒绝上传。假如允许上传的话,则所有的文件是及所拥有,而且其文件权限是。 例如: upload /var/ftp * no upload /var/ftp /incoming yes ftp daemon 0666 upload /var/ftp /incoming/gifs yes jlc guest 0600 nodirs 上面的设置只允许文件上传到/incoming及/incomeing/gifs这二个目录,被上传到/incoming的文件其所有权将是ftp/daemon,而其权限是0666;被上传到/incoming/gifs的文件,其所有权将是jlc/guest,而其权限是0600。注意是指ftp目录;必须跟系统密码文件内 (/etc/passwd) 的使用者目录一致。 此外,dirs及nodirs这二个选项可有可无。这二个选项是指:允许(dirs)或不允许(nodirs)使用mkdir这个指令来产生新的子目录。 注意,假如不指明的话,“产生新的子目录”这个权限是默认是被允许的。 这个选项决定新产生子目录的权限。假如被省略,则目录权限将会是;若是也没有的话,则新产生子目录的权限将是777。 注意,上传这个功能只对"用户主目录" (或使用者的根目录?) 在底下的使用者有效。假如把设为"*"的话,则不受此限制。更进一步说明,就是指chroot()这个指令的输入参数。 及也可以设定成"*"。在这个情况下,任何上传的文件及新产生子目录的所有权将被设置成与其所在的上层目录所有权一致。 [absolute|relative] 这个选项可有可无。这个选项定义这个目录将被解释为绝对路径 (absolute),或是目前chroot环境的相对路径 (relative)。预设是绝对路径 (absolute)。[class=] 这个选项一定要有。yes是指允许上传,反之则禁止
‘肆’ ftp服务器允许上传东西,建立文件夹(包括命名),不允许删除,文件限权要怎么设置
首先确定你用的是不是sever-u建立的ftp
如果是就好办了
把你的管理权限的用户名加上16位以上的密码
然后给他们建立一个可以上传还有创建文件夹的用户
不开放删除跟运行功能(很多木马程序如果可以运行就可以删东西)就可以了
‘伍’ 在linux中开启ftp上传权限
这个很简单,可能是你的ftp工作目录中对于其他用户没有写权限,或者在配置文件当中没有加上写入权限。linux中的各种服务对权限的要求是很高的,都是以最严格的为准。
‘陆’ 如何设置ftp上传者权限
ftp不能设置上传文件的权限,原因是:
ftp只是将文件流上传到服务器上,而文件的读写属性是不包括在内的,他是由您连接的服务器上的操作系统决定的,例如linux。如果你要设置权限,只能是通过服务器的操作系统来设置,而不能通过ftp来设置文件上传权限。